(MENAFN) The UAE’s Telecom Regulatory Authority’s (TRA) director, Mohammed Al Ghanem, stated that after 2015, the authority may award licenses to new telecom operators in the country, reported Emirates 24/7.
Al Ghanem added that the UAE, which has two telecom operators, Etisalat and Du, has inked an agreement with the World Trade Organization (WTO) that demands the country to consider opening up its telecom sector to other operators by the end of 2015.
However, he said that at the current time, the second largest Arab economy has no plans to introduce new telecom operators until that date.
It is worth noting that as of the end of May, the UAE’s telecom sector posted around 15.1 million subscribers.
